Transaction 0677d232ee71d20c89fc1626aa95bf48283fd92f3be9b65a5b64421e895a75d7
1 Input
1 Output
-
0677d232ee71d20c89fc1626aa95bf48283fd92f3be9b65a5b64421e895a75d7:0
- value
- 13414
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c3032267addd5ff9c45f0b719408884e9e1edff
- address
- bc1qescryfn6mh2ll8z97zm3jsygsn57rm0lyzuyau